Automation Developer Resume
Charlotte, NC
EXPERIENCE SUMMARY:
- 10 years experience in Software Testing as an Automation Test Analyst/ Lead in UI Automation tools (Selenium and UFT / QTP Frameworks) and Middleware Webservice Automation tools (SOAP UI, Greenhat Tester/IBM RIT) with a good understanding of Software Testing Life Cycle (STLC).
- 5 Years of Experience in Webservice Testing Automation (SOAP XML, REST JSON and MQ messages) using Greenhat Tester / IBM Rational Integration Tester and using SOAP UI.
- Currently working on Coded UI Test Automation in Visual Studio Ultimate version and Integrate the Coded UI Tests with TFS and MTM.
- 2 Years of Experience in working with open source tool Selenium (Selenium Web Driver), TestNG framework.
- Well understanding of HTML and able to identify the objects using HTML DOM properties in Java based automation test scripts creation.
- Developed Modular and Hybrid QTP / UFT Framework using VB script, Descriptive Programming.
- 9 Years of experience in using test management tool HP ALM / QC and proficient in Integration of ALM with other tools like RIT, UFT, and Excel.
- Test Planning and Coordinator for Settlement & Reconciliation Testing for Online Consumer payments, IVR payments and for Digital Funds Disbursements.
- 3 Years of Experience in Conduction UAT Testing at Confidential and Coordinating End to End Testing with SIT and UAT teams as a Test Lead for the Initiative.
- Trained in Next Gen UI Automation tool - TOSCA, and submitted few POC’s on automation capabilities of TOSCA.
- Worked as an onshore coordinator in Confidential, handled offshore teams from multiple vendors and with cross functional teams.
- Knowledge on ETL workflows testing using Informatica Power center - Mapping Designer, Repository manager, Workflow Manager/Monitor and Server tools - Informatica Server, Repository Server manager.
- Experience in using TOAD for Oracle - writing Complex Oracle queries on daily basis for database validations and for Validating ETL Transformations.
- Certified as “Oracle Certified SQL Expert”
- Proficient in developing scripts using VB Scripting and developed Excel Macros based on project needs.
- SME in Small Business & consumer Payments Domain in Confidential, since 5 Years, dealing with Inter Bank, Intra Bank ACH and International Wire Transfers.
- Extensive QA experience in different phases of Testing Lifecycle, starting from Involving in SAD(System Architecture Design) and HLD /LLD design discussions, Requirement Analysis, Test Planning, Test Design, Execution and Test Reporting & Defect Management.
- Experience in working closely with Application Architects, Product Owners, functional specialists, developers, and database administrators to develop test scenarios based on requirements and conduct test case execution and planning as well as analyze results against requirements.
- Expert in End to End System Integration test planning and design in US Banking - Payments Domain.
- Well Understanding of Service Oriented Architecture concepts and Web services design - “Certified as IBM SOA Associate”
- Expert in understanding and creation of ACH - NACHA (National Account Clearing House Association) Business Rules in Payments Domain.
- Proficient in Implementation and Execution of Agile Testing Process. Worked with JIRA tool for agile process implementation.
- Overall, worked in Auto Finance, Retail, Insurance, Banking and Payments Domains, and Expertise in Small Business and Consumer Payments via ACH in U.S.A.
TECHNICAL COMPETENCIES:
Testing Tools:
For Webservice Testing: IBM RIT, Greenhat Tester, SOAP UI
For UI Automation: Selenium Webdriver, UFT/QTP, HP ALM
SQL/Oracle Querying: Oracle, SQL Server 2010/20 13, MySQL, TO AD
Version Control: Perforce
Other Tools used: Java Eclipse, SSH Tectia
PROFESSIONAL EXPERIENCE:
Confidential, Charlotte, NC
Automation Developer
Tools: Selenium, Visual Studio Ultimate - Coded UI
Responsibilities:
- POC Design on Selenium Framework for the treasury management Applications
- Coded UI Test Automation Development using Visual Studio Ultimate in C# Language
- Configure TFS Build Definition and Setting up Agents to run coded UI.
- Set up Lab Environments in MTM lab Center and Install test Agents to run coded UI tests from MTM.
- Auto Upload the Test Cases to MTM, Execute Manual Test Cases and Automated Coded UI Test Builds from MTM.
- Integrate Coded UI tests with TFS (Team Foundation Server) and MTM for Continuous Integration.
- Develop Customized Reporting Functions to report test results.
Confidential
Lead Analyst & SME
Environment: SOA, JAVA, .Net
Tools: Selenium Webdriver, Green Hat Tester (SOA Web service Testing Tool), SOAP UI, QC 9.0, QTP 9.2, Toad-Oracle, Java Eclipse, SAHI, Perforce Version control tool.
Responsibilities:
- SOA Web services integration Test Automation and reporting using SOAP UI, Greenhat Tester and IBM RIT(Rational Integration Tester)
- Automate SOAP, REST and MQ calls using IBM Rational Integration Tester.
- Design, execute and maintain Selenium Web Driver, automated test cases for regression test cases
- Identified the Automation scenarios, Designed/Setup the framework, prepared the UI Object Info, Functions, test Data, Prepared the Test Suite using JAVA Framework TestNG , Executed the Scripts, and updated the scripts as part of maintenance.
- Automated one of the Monitoring UI Application using UFT, Hybrid framework using descriptive Programming.
- Test Extraction of data from various sources(Oracle, Flat files) and Transforming based on business rules and Loading into the target database using ETL Informatica power center,
- Schedule and run jobs using Autosys job scheduler.
- Validate Application logs in Unix server using SSH tectia tool an debug the problems using the logs extracted.
- Performed parameterization of the automated test scripts in Selenium to check how the application performs against multiple sets of data
- Wr ite automation test cases and fixing automation script bugs
- ACH files creation and reporting to other settlement systems to test other bank payments.
- Participated in Daily Scrum/Stand-up/status meeting, Sprint planning and demo meetings, weekly assessment meetings with business analysts, developers, DBA and others.
- Test Scripts Development, Execution, Monitoring, and Defect Reporting
- Test Management and Defect tracking and reporting in Quality center.
- Version Controling using perforce.
- End to End Testing Coordinator and Integration test lead for Payment Applications.
- Interact with SIT Functional Test Teams for an initiative for Planning and Scheduling UAT test plan.
- Test Planning and Coordinator for Settlement & Reconciliation Testing for Online Consumer payments, IVR payments and for Digital Funds Disbursements.
- Involve in all Requirement Analysis meetings and HLD / LLD review meetings and all SIT Teams Test plan reviews to understand the End to End requirement and for a better UAT Test Scenarios Planning.
- UAT Test Plan Review and Presentation to the Project Teams and to SIT test Leads.
- Collect project metrics and report on weekly/monthly basis.
- Involved in Resource planning and task distribution for all phases of testing.
- Responsible for regular updates to QC/HP ALM and for Triage meetings.
- Recognize change management issues and risks; develop recommendations and mitigating strategies. the new resources
- Experienced Business Analyst, SME and Quality Analyst in payment technology with experience in all phases of IT project management. Key strengths include leading requirements definition and functional design, working with client and multiple stakeholders.
- Specialties: Business process analysis and facilitation, Coordination of off-shore vendor resources, Solution design and estimates, Business use case development, Systems integration testing.
- Submitted various documents to the project teams in both Automation Tools and Project overview to train new joiners.
- SME for Test Automation Tools and responsible for managing the proprietary automation frameworks.
- Testing SPOC for P2P product to support all downstream systems during integration testing.
- Providing the business and testing support to the business partners testing the same application.
- Fun at work and Team building activities as an Employment Engagement Spoc.
Confidential
Test Lead - Offshore
Environment: JAVA
Tools: Green Hat Tester (SOA Web service Testing Tool), QC 8.2.
Responsibilities:
- Requirement Analysis and Project Planning.
- Team Formation and Project Initiation activities
- Test Deliverables - Component Service Testing phase
- Web service test automation using Green Hat Tester
- Change Request Analysis
- Change Management techniques
- Defect Triage, Defect Tracking and Closure
- Responsible for Daily Status Reports and Weekly Status Reports for 13 parallel web component test releases
- Test Planning and Resource Loading for all phases of testing - CST, ST, SIT and Regression.
Confidential
Automation Test Engineer - Offshore
Environment: VB and JAVA
Tools: QTP 10.0 and QC 8.2
Responsibilities:
- Deriving the Test Automation Approach using QTP V10.0 and QC V8.2
- Implementation of Hybrid Framework in Automation Approach
- Test Script Design, Development and Execution
- Integration of Test Scripts with QC and Reporting the Results to QC.
- Offshore Point Of Contact for test scripts delivery
- Test Completion Report
Confidential
Senior Test Engineer - Offshore
Environment: .Net, Windows XP.
Tools: QC 9.0.
Responsibilities:
- Creating Test suit for the Regression test cycles
- Regression Test Execution and Bug Reporting
- Onsite - Offshore coordination
Confidential
Test Lead - Onsite
Environment: Mainframe, Oracle 9i, .Net, Windows XP.
Tools: Clear Quest, QC 9.0.
Responsibilities:
- Deliver Knowledge Transision from Client to Offshore
- Deliver the SMTD and Playback Presentation to Client and made the client confidant and succeeded on getting the next phase
- Daily KT status reports and Understanding documents on the application.
- Onsite Offshore coordination and support to all down stream applications at onsite
- Test Execution through Quality Center 9.0
- Defect Management in Quality Center 9.0
- Preparation of Traceability Matrix in Quality Center 9.0
- Conduction Bug Triage meetings with Client.
- Preparation of Metrics reports for Offshore Team members.
Confidential
Senior Test Engineer
Environment: Mainframe, Oracle 9i, .Net, Windows XP.
Tools: QTP 9.2, QC 9.2.
Responsibilities:
- Design and Script generation using QTP 8.2.
- Developped reusable scripts/functions for all credit policy validations.
- Prepared the Daily & Weekly status report and sending to the client.
- Prepared the Agile Metrics.
- Assigning the task to the team members.
- Responsible for Analysing and Prioritising the regression test cases/scripts during the regressin cycle of every release.
- Integrated the QTP scripts with QC and executed the scripts directly from QC.
- Test results review and reporting.
- Logging and reporting the defects in QC.
- Participated in Daily Status Client Calls.
- Script Maintenance and Execution.
Confidential
Test Engineer
Environment: .Net, Oracle Server.
Tools: QTP 8.2, QC
Responsibilities:
- Creating the low level design documents for the regression test suite.
- Creating User defined Functions using the Automation tools.
